Organizations| Alzheimer's Association | | 225 North Michigan Avenue, Floor 17 | | Chicago, IL 60601-7633 | | Phone: | 1-800-272-3900 | | Fax: | 1-866-699-1246 toll-free | | TDD: | 1-866-403-3073 toll-free | | E-mail: | info@alz.org | | Web Address: | www.alz.org | | | The Alzheimer's Association is a national organization that
provides educational materials, support groups, and community services for
people dealing with Alzheimer's disease. It has more than 200 local chapters
throughout the United States. The organization publishes a newsletter as well
as a wide range of brochures and videos. The Web site includes a lot of useful
information for people with Alzheimer's and other dementias, as well as for
their caregivers. |
